HP Envy x360 15.6 inch 2-in-1 Laptop PC 15-fe0000 (77X86AV)
Microsoft Windows 11

This is a new Envy 2in1  15-fe0097nr Windows 11 laptop.  I would like to use it with the laptop lid closed so it

fits under an external monitor on my desk.  Laptop is connected to an ASUS PA278CV ,  resolution 2560 x 1440 external monitor, with either a 10 Gb/s USB-C cable or an HDMI cable.  The W11 Display setting are set for "Duplicate" display, and I have tried both the 2560x1440 and the 1920x1080 resolution settings.  The symptoms described here occur with either resolution setting.   The symptoms described also occur with either the USB-C cable or the HDMI.  The W11 Power options are set so that lid closure is "Do Nothing".

Problem:

When the laptop lid is open, everything works just fine.  When the laptop lid is closed, the laptop screen goes black,

and the external monitor screen also goes black for about 3 sec, then resumes display of whatever was on it, but with

a smaller font size and reduced width of the content that was on the screen, the details depending on the particular web site.  The smaller font size and content width are, of course, related.   The laptop screen remains black, but the laptop is still running.   Reopenning the laptop lid immediately restores the previoius proper display.  I want this to work so that the external monitor continues to show the very same display when the lid is closed.

 

ASUS tech support concluded the problem was with the settings on the laptop after several expements (monitor reset, and connection of laptop to TV).  He felt that the laptop was somehow resetting the display options even though set 

to "Do Nothing".

 

In addition, I have connected an older W10 Spectre x360 to the monitor with the HDMI cable, and the W10 display and lid closure settings as in the case of the new Envy laptop.  SAME SYMPTOMS !

 

I suspect I have not set the W11 settings properly, or, more likely a display driver needs adjusting or replacing.

 

I have been playing with this now for 3 days.  Any help appreciated.
